Your role 

This is a fixed term role expected to conclude 26 June 2025. 

You will be responsible for driving organisational change and growth through the implementation and adoption of the new Home Care Platform software solution. The role is responsible for consulting with internal and external stakeholders, developing business strategies, and process improvement plans to assist in the successful delivery of the Home Care Platform project.

No two days are the same in this role, your responsibilities include: 

  • Lead business processes and identify areas for optimisation and transformation using applicable methodologies such as BPM, Lean, Six Sigma and Kaizen to lead and drive process excellence initiatives. Focus on aligning business processes with strategic objectives to enhance efficiency and effectiveness. 
  • Manage the implementation strategy through coordinating the implementation activities, ensuring all business transformation strategies are integrated with the organisation’s enterprise architecture and business processes.  
  • Work closely with the Product Owner, Project Manager, and Project Trainer to develop and deliver targeted training materials that ensure end-user competence. 
  • Collaborate with key stakeholders to foster effective teamwork and ensure smooth adoption of new processes.  
  • Map out and subsequently lead change management efforts to ensure a smooth transition to a new platform and monitor adoption of new processes.  
  • Provide ongoing support and drive continuous improvement efforts post-implementation to sustain benefits realisation.  
  • Ensure all process documentation meets legislative and regulatory requirements. 
  • Advocate for high quality standards and continuous improvement across the project. 
  • Advise on best practices in change and transformation processes to help drive strategic decisions affecting the project's scope and direction. 

About you 

You have a proven track record in managing complex business transformation projects, especially technical integrations. You will have exceptional communication skills and be able to manage stakeholders at various levels. 

You have a passion for the design and delivery of processes that are person centered and ensure positive customer experience. 

  • Degree or postgraduate qualification in Information Technology, Business, or other relevant discipline.  
  • Change Management qualification/certification (including change and communication management frameworks).  
  • Lean Six Sigma Green Belt of higher.  
  • Proficiency in process design, particularly BPMN 2.0.  
  • Current driver’s licence. 
  • Five years’ experience in roles focused on business transformation, change management or process improvement.  
  • Experience with business process reengineering, process mapping and workflow analysis.
